Community Clinic in Northwest Arkansas is partnering with the NWA Food Conservatory to bring fresh, locally-sourced fruits and vegetables to patients. 

  • At the doctor's: The partnership was formed to encourage and help patients develop healthier habits and treat chronic diseases like diabetes and obesity. The clinic and conservatory are doing this through a weekly distribution of low-cost produce right at the doctor's office. 
  • Healthier generation: The Community Clinic is available to everyone who needs it and prides itself on working with marginalized communities and families. By providing local healthy food options to its patients, the clinic is not only fostering healthier patients but potentially building a new generation of nutrition security as well.
